Assume that couple will have three children, letting B denote a boy and G denote a girl.
a) Draw a tree diagram depicting the sample space outcomes for this experiment.
b) List the sample space outcomes that correspond to each of following events:
1) All 3 children will have same gender.
2) Exactly two of the three children will be girls
3) Exactly one of the three children will be girl
4) None of the three children will be a girl
c) Suppose that all sample space outcomes are equaly likely, determine the probability of each of events given in part b.
